I am AGAINST this proposal because I do not believe Hippostania has violated all of these resolutions. Resolution 9: Prevention of Torture No evidence is given that Hippostania tortures the people whom it imprisons. Resolution 27: Freedom of Assembly This resolution protects only peaceful assembly and does not protect calls for violence. The Hippostanian law being criticized by this proposal outlaws:
Resolution 30: Freedom of Expression This resolution excludes from protection "incitements to widespread lawlessness and disorder." The goal of anarchism, which Hippostania forbids, is lawlessness. Communism, which Hippostania forbids, calls for revolution against the existing social order. Resolution 35: The Charter of Civil Rights In this proposal, no evidence is given that Hippostania has violated this resolution. Resolution 43: WA Labor Relations Act The condemnation proposal is correct here. Hippostania, because it has a laissez-faire economy, does not protect the rights of workers. Unions are technically allowed; although, the lack of labor regulations in Hippostania does make it difficult for them to exist. Business owners do what they can in Hippostania to smother unions. Resolution 174: Right to Petition No evidence is given that Hippostania restricts the right to petition. |
